Wondering whats the best exhaust 2 into 2 for upgrades including cam? I'm thinking V & H short shots? not concerned about emissions. Fat Boy114
Short pipes aren't doing the M8 any favors this generation. Paraphrasing here, Fuelmoto and Kevin Baxter are both sorta reiterating the point that the M8 is liking longer exhaust, than shorter ones. Kevin mentioned in his new cam video that the stock exhaust choices are doing fairly well for power with the M8.

Short shots were what I wanted to get at one point. But you can't argue with dyno results; the M8 literally loses power with short 2into2 systems. Inserts such as Thunder Torque or lollipops can help return some of the lost torque, but they may only bring it back to factory-mufflers level power. For that real Stage 1 effect, any full length 2into1 will give best results. S&S SuperStreet, Thunderheader X-Series, Rinehart are all good choices.
Cobra's powerport 2 into 1 into 2s should be just as good as well. The Speedster 909s, and Speedster Slashdowns both have crosspower ports and behave like a 2 into 1.
But yeah any shorty pipe that doesn't have a crossover scavenge should be avoided for the M8s.
